Output 37d5c50a371f33784015ae488acaec9b78a8b4f0f2d5f49d0d3a156b62134e54:0

value
28478284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ddfdeab9b6ac9a3784fb0b2f5d790813490ef9f OP_EQUAL
address
37LBKzW6ZGitiphnqW6xhh4y3ajxacukYw
transaction
37d5c50a371f33784015ae488acaec9b78a8b4f0f2d5f49d0d3a156b62134e54
spent
true